Plectranthus ternifolius
Family: Lamiaceae
What it is like
A small shrub. It has a dense grey covering. The leaves are 15 cm long. They are in rings and have short stalks. The leaves are sword shaped and taper to the tip. They have teeth along the edge. The flowers are white and in dense groups. The fruit are small nutlets.
Where it is found
It is a tropical and subtropical plant. It suits damp and shady places.
Countries/locations it is found in
Asia, India, Indochina, Myanmar, Northeastern India, SE Asia, Thailand
How it is used for food
The young shoots are cooked and eaten as a vegetable with fish or meat. The fresh harvested shoots can be stored 4-5 days.
It is popular.
